Austria
One of the things I look forward the most every year is a song that I didn’t really notice in studio bringing a few minutes of unexpected magic on stage, and this year it’s Austria. I always say about those mellow, atmospheric songs that they can be amazing if the staging gets it right – but that it’s also hard to get the staging right for that kind of song.
Well, everyone, take a page out of Austria’s book. It’s mostly dark, but they create this look of floating lights, and the camera transitions really help to draw you in. Pænda brings honesty and vulnerability as well as stunning vocals – I knew she was good, but didn’t realize she was THAT good! Bonus points for her interacting with the triangles on the ceiling, too. It’s just mesmerizing. I still can’t actually say how this will do results-wise, because this semi has a lot of options for both the juries and the televoters, but I’m not complaining.
